WebWhen we use the term late, which means dead, before someone’s name, we show that they’ve passed away, aka is no longer with us. It’s a respectful way of acknowledging that they’re no longer here among the living and that their time on this earth has ended. WebThis is because pass away is more polite than saying died. People would much rather hear that you are sorry their family member passed away than saying you are sorry their family member died.
